BITS WILP AIML – Program Details!
1. First Things First – You Have Enrolled !
Congrats on enrolling in the BITS WILP AIML program! Here’s what to expect post-admission:
- Email Updates: Watch your inbox. BITS Pilani sends:
- Login details for the Taxila LMS Portal
- Access to Microsoft Teams for live classes
- Your official BITS Gmail ID
- Orientation Sessions:
- Program-wide and AIML-specific sessions
- Covers curriculum, evaluation, tools, and support systems
- Comes with detailed PPTs — don’t skip them!
2. Details about BITS WILP AIML Exams !
- Two exams are conducted throughout the semester.
- A mid semester Test
- A Comprehensive Exam
- Each of these two exams are conducted twice as a regular mode and a make up mode where one can take an examination at a separate date if one was not able to join the regular exam.

3. WILP Grading Procedure
Relative grading it is ! Don’t worry too much about minimum marks needed to pass etc. Everything will depend on how difficult the subject was and how your batchmates performed in it. For tough subjects like Mathematics for machine learning pass mark could be just 5/30 in mid-sem or could be 20/30 for easier subjects like ISM.
BITS Pilani follows a relative grading procedure for all its Work Integrated Learning Programmes, including the AIML program. This means that the final grade you receive in each course is not solely based on your absolute score but rather on how your performance compares to that of your fellow students in the same course. Therefore, concerns about a fixed minimum mark required to pass should be considered in the context of the overall performance of the cohort and the inherent difficulty of the subject matter. As highlighted earlier, the passing threshold might vary significantly between different courses based on these factors.
- Students are graded with relative grading
- Letter grades Range from A, A−, B, B−, C, C−, D and E where each letter corresponds to grade points 10, 9, 8, 7, 6, 5, 4 and 2 respectively
- For project work a non-letter grade is awarded such as EXCELLENT, GOOD, FAIR and POOR.
- If a student is absent for any of the written examination, the student will be declared as a RRA (Required to Register Again) for that course.
- The CGPA awarded in a 10 point scale is calculated as:CGPA=(U1G1+U2G2+U3G3+U4G4)(U1+U2+U3+U4)Where U1, U2, U3 and U4 denote the Units associated with the courses taken G1, G2, G3 and G4 denote the Grade Points awarded in the respective courses.
- Non Letter Grades DO NOT go into CGPA Computation

💡 Pro Tips to Succeed in BITS WILP AIML
To maximize your chances of success in the BITS WILP AIML program, consider incorporating the following expert tips into your study routine. Time management is paramount given the demanding nature of balancing professional work with academic studies. Creating a realistic and consistent study schedule and adhering to it diligently will be crucial for covering the curriculum effectively. Active engagement in the learning process is highly recommended. Participate actively in live lectures, don’t hesitate to ask questions to clarify doubts, and contribute to discussions on online forums to enhance your understanding and connect with your peers.
Make the most of the available resources provided by BITS Pilani and this blog.
- Stick to a Schedule: Build a consistent, realistic study plan.
- Participate Actively: Ask questions during live lectures and join discussions.
- Use Available Resources: Don’t ignore the LMS, this blog, or your peers.
- Practice Diligently: Solve past papers, complete assignments, and code regularly.
- Connect with Faculty: Don’t hesitate to clarify doubts with professors or TAs.
- Stay Informed: Keep an eye on your BITS email and LMS for updates.
- Focus on Concepts: Aim for deep understanding, not just memorization.
